Exactly what does "I am Yahudiym" signify?
When somebody claims, "I'm Yahudiym," the assertion normally demonstrates a connection on the people today of Judah along with the broader property of Israel explained throughout Scripture.
The phrase Yahudiym is connected to Judah, one of the twelve tribes of Israel. all over biblical history, Judah occupied a central position during the preservation of worship, Management, and covenant obligation. The kings of David's line came as a result of Judah, and lots of prophetic claims are connected to this tribe.
For numerous believers, determining as Yahudiym is not only about ancestry. it really is about embracing the teachings, duties, and covenant obligations uncovered within just Scripture. It includes studying the Torah, observing the Sabbath, honoring the feast times, and looking for to walk based on the commandments.

Philippians three:5 and Israelite identification
amongst A very powerful verses relating to identity appears in Philippians 3:five.
Paul writes:
"Circumcised the eighth day, on the inventory of Israel, from the tribe of Benjamin, an Hebrew in the Hebrews."
This statement is significant because Paul openly acknowledged his heritage and tribal lineage.
Paul didn't deny his link to Israel. Instead, he clearly recognized himself as remaining through the tribe of Benjamin and described himself being a Hebrew in the Hebrews.
Many academics and artists throughout the Israelite Music Neighborhood reference Philippians three:five mainly because it demonstrates the continued great importance of Israelite identification within the New Testament writings.
The verse reminds viewers that biblical id wasn't erased. instead, it remained part of the historical and covenant framework reviewed in the course of Scripture.

Romans seven:twelve along with the Holiness from the Torah
One more foundational passage for TorahMusic is Romans 7:twelve.
Paul declares:
"Wherefore the regulation is holy, and the commandment holy, and just, and superior."
This verse is often deemed one of several clearest statements concerning the Torah within the New testomony.
Romans 7:12 teaches the commandments are:
Holy
Just
superior
These 3 descriptions sort the inspiration For a lot of Torah-centered musical messages.
Artists building TorahMusic regularly use Romans seven:twelve to display that obedience just isn't a thing damaging. Instead, obedience is portrayed to be a blessing along with a tutorial for righteous residing.
